New Airstreams
Took a drive over to the local Airstream dealership today. Almost wished I had stayed home. They had several 2016 Bambis in stock and a large number of 2015. Beautiful trailers inside and out but some of the most uncomfortable seating. Horrible things. First order of business would be to rip them out and put in comfortable recliners. I was very impressed with the wood choices and over all fit and finish. Waiting patiently for the new layout 26U. It is a very impressive and comfortable looking model with what appears to be upgraded seating thruout. Still going to be a few months before Airstream gets back up to full and increased production levels after the expansion according to the manager but smaller 2016 models are rolling out the door and hitting showrooms.
